Deciphering the Test: Grasping Question Types and Formats

Taking a test can feel like navigating a maze if you don't recognize the various question types and formats. A solid grasp of these elements can significantly boost your performance. Start by familiarizing yourself with common question structures, such as multiple choice, true/false, matching, short answer, and essay questions. Each format has its unique characteristics and requires a separate approach. By analyzing the type of question, you can plan your response effectively.

  • Multiple choice questions present several answers, with one being the correct answer.
  • True/false questions require you to determine whether a statement is accurate or not.
  • Matching questions involve pairing terms with their corresponding definitions or examples.
  • Short answer questions call for concise and specific responses.
  • Essay questions demand in-depth analysis on a particular topic.

Practice identifying different question types in your study materials and past exams. This will help you develop a sense of comfort and confidence when encountering them during the actual test. here Remember, understanding the format is the first step towards attaining success.

Evaluating Student Progress Beyond Metrics

Focusing solely on standardized test scores presents a narrow picture of student achievement. While these assessments can provide valuable data, they often fail to capture the multifaceted nature of learning. A truly holistic approach requires utilizing a range of indicators that assess student growth in both academic and interpersonal domains.

By means of alternative assessments, portfolios, project-based tasks, and teacher observations, educators can cultivate a richer comprehension into students' capacities. This multidimensional approach allows us to celebrate the unique paths of each student and nurture their progress in meaningful ways.
